How do I pick a future employer?

By taking enough time to orientate yourself. Start by listing down what are your ‘need to haves’, followed by ‘nice to haves’, in order to create a list of basic job requirements. When you found yourself a pool of interesting companies, register for Inhousedays or other events. In the end your feeling has to be right, and being ‘inhouse’, meeting the people, seeing yourself walking in that particular office, is what matters the most.
